Role PurposeThe Cabin Cleaning Lead is responsible for leading a team of Cabin Cleaning Agents in a safe and efficient cleaning of the interior of a commercial aircraft while ensuring the safety in the airplane cabin according to Company/Carrier’s standards.
What You Will Be Doing- Lead agents in cleaning all assigned commercial aircraft thoroughly and efficiently
- Assist Cabin Cleaning Agents in their assigned areas to ensure Agents are performing their duties in a professional, safe, and efficient manner, according to Company/Carrier’s standards
- Train employees during on-the-job training and/or airline specific training or assign employees to work with an experienced agent
- Ensure preparation of all cleaning supplies such as solvents, etc., for the cleaning of commercial aircraft
- Ensure that all cleaning equipment is in working order and that all protective clothing is worn as instructed
- Vacuum, sweep, dust, disinfect, and clean all areas of the aircraft
- Based on individual customer requests may be required to remove blankets and pillows and replace them with clean ones
- Ensure that soiled linens are deposited into the laundry bin
- Ensure that all cleaning supplies and equipment are returned to the designated storage area
- Perform other duties as assigned

- Must be 18 years of age or older
- Six (6) months of janitorial, customer service or hospitality experience
- Possess and maintain valid US driver's license
- Must be able to pass all pre-employment testing to include drug testing and a physical
- Ability to proficiently read, write and speak English
-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out instructions furnished in written, oral, or diagram form
- Must be comfortable lifting 70 lbs repetitively
Must be able to obtain and maintain all required Airports and Custom badges/seals - Must be available and flexible to work variable shifts including weekends and holidays
- The job is done both in and outdoors which will require you to work in all weather conditions
- Previous cabin cleaning experience
- Previous aircraft cabin cleaning, janitorial, hospitality, or airport operations experience
- Prior leadership or supervisory experience
